Which side of the mountain is better to live on?

Leeward Mountain Slopes Encourage Warm, Dry Climates

In contrast to the moist windward side of a mountain, the leeward side typically has a dry, warm climate. This is because by the time air rises up the windward side and reaches the summit, it has already been stripped of the majority of its moisture.

Do you sleep better at higher altitude?

Sleep at high altitude is characterized by poor subjective quality, increased awakenings, frequent brief arousals, marked nocturnal hypoxemia, and periodic breathing. A change in sleep architecture with an increase in light sleep and decreasing slow-wave and REM sleep have been demonstrated.

Are mountains good for lungs?

The air at higher altitudes is colder, less dense, and contains fewer oxygen molecules . This means that you need to take more breaths in order to get the same amount of oxygen as you would at lower altitudes. The higher the elevation, the more difficult breathing becomes.

What are the dangers on a mountain?

Blizzards of heavy snowfall, strong winds, freezing temperatures and low visibility can present a variety of dangers to people on the mountain. The extreme temperatures mean that frostbite and hypothermia can be real dangers in the mountains. Earthquakes and eruptions are hazards on volcanic mountains.

What are the life zones on mountains?

Elevation is the determining factor in locating and identifying the variety of plants and animals found in Rocky, and the park can easily be divided into three main zones: the montane ecosystem, at lower elevations; the subalpine, at the midlevels; and the alpine, at the park’s highest elevations .
